Extra Points: When It Rains...


The frustration on offense is nearing epic proportions. Through six games, the Tar Heels are averaging 25 points and 373 yards per game, well below norms at UNC from 2012-16 of 35 points and 454 yards. North Carolina is hitting just 30 percent of its third-downs and has yielded 13 sacks. It's lost four fumbles and thrown six interceptions. (GoHeels.com)
